Why Non Stick Cooking Oil Spray is Necessary

I find non stick cooking oil spray necessary because it makes cooking much easier and less stressful. When I spray a pan before cooking, my food is less likely to stick, which means I can flip eggs, pancakes, or fish more smoothly without ruining their shape. It also helps me save time since I do not have to scrub stubborn food off the pan afterward.

My experience has shown me that it also helps me use less oil overall. Instead of pouring too much oil into the pan, I can apply a light, even layer with just a quick spray. This makes my cooking feel cleaner and more controlled, and I like that it can support a lighter way of preparing meals.

I also appreciate how useful it is for baking and grilling. I use it on pans, trays, and sometimes even grill surfaces to help prevent sticking and make cleanup easier. For me, it is a simple kitchen tool that saves effort, protects my cookware, and helps my food turn out better.

My Buying Guides on Non Stick Cooking Oil Spray

Why I Use Non Stick Cooking Oil Spray

When I cook, I want food to release easily without leaving a mess behind. That is why I use non stick cooking oil spray. It helps me coat pans, baking trays, and grills evenly with very little oil. I also like that it saves time and makes cleanup much easier.

What I Look for Before Buying

Before I choose a spray, I always check a few important things. I look at the ingredients, the type of oil used, the spray quality, and whether it is suitable for the kind of cooking I do. I also pay attention to whether it contains additives or propellants I may want to avoid.

Ingredients Matter to Me

I prefer a spray with simple ingredients. For me, the best options usually contain just oil and maybe a natural emulsifier. I try to avoid products with unnecessary fillers or artificial additives. If I want a cleaner choice, I look for sprays made with olive oil, avocado oil, or coconut oil.

The Type of Oil I Choose

Different oils work better for different uses. When I cook at high heat, I like sprays made with avocado oil or canola oil because they handle heat well. For baking, I may choose a neutral oil so it does not change the flavor of my food. If I want a richer taste, I sometimes use olive oil spray.

Heat Resistance Is Important

I always check the smoke point before buying. If I plan to fry, roast, or grill, I need a spray that can handle higher temperatures without burning easily. A higher smoke point gives me more confidence that my food will cook properly and taste better.

Spray Performance and Coverage

I like a spray that gives an even mist instead of a heavy stream. Good coverage helps me use less oil and keeps my pans from getting sticky in spots. I also prefer a spray that works consistently and does not clog too often.

Flavor and Odor

I pay attention to whether the spray has a strong smell or taste. For most of my cooking, I want something neutral. That way, the oil does not overpower the flavor of my food. If I am making a dish where the oil flavor matters, then I choose accordingly.

Packaging and Ease of Use

I prefer a bottle that feels comfortable to hold and is easy to spray. A reliable nozzle matters a lot to me because it makes cooking smoother. I also like packaging that is sturdy and easy to store in my kitchen.

Health and Dietary Preferences

If I am trying to eat lighter, I use non stick cooking oil spray because it helps me control portions better than pouring oil. I also check for labels such as non-GMO, gluten-free, or keto-friendly if those matter to my diet. For me, the label should match my lifestyle and cooking needs.

Price and Value

I do not always choose the cheapest option. I look for value instead. A slightly more expensive spray can be worth it if it lasts longer, sprays better, and uses better ingredients. I compare the cost per use, not just the bottle price.

My Final Buying Tip

My best advice is to choose a non stick cooking oil spray that fits the way I cook most often. I focus on ingredients, heat resistance, spray quality, and taste. When I find the right one, cooking becomes easier, cleaner, and more enjoyable.
